Here is where you can choose what you would like to display in the View Window. To show these items in the View Window, click in the box that is to the left of the option. A check mark in the box symbolizes that the option will be displayed. Click again to remove the check mark, which symbolizes that the option will not be displayed.
Save As Default: Any time that you change a setting or settings and click the Save As Default button your changes will be saved. Even if you exit out of EDS IV and get back in again, your default settings will be saved.
Show Connectors: This lets you view the connecting lines between elements. Basically they can be thought of as the needle movement from a tie off on one element to the tie in of another element. Connectors are viewed as dotted black lines in the View Window.
Show Expanded Points: This lets you view the expanded points of a design.
Show Stitches: This lets you view the stitches as they would appear in a sewout.
Show Wireframe Lines: This lets you view the wireframe outline of the element.
Show Wireframe Points: This lets you view the wireframe points of the element.
Any time that you are in a property page, you can click "Apply" after making a change and it will immediately apply your change. The advantage of using "Apply" verses clicking "OK" after a change is that you can apply your changes and still move on to making other changes. Once you click on "OK", your changes will be applied and the property dialogues will close and you will be back at the View Window. You can also click "Cancel" and the property dialogues will close without implementing the last change.
